Minichamps again

I'm affraid i'm getting the bug:

Just started my collection and have decided to collect as many of the championship winning bikes from GP, WSB & BSB. Maybe a test bike or two also

Just bought two 1:12 scale bikes: a 2001 996 Bayliss #21 (not imola) for £35 and a 2001 Rossi NSR #46 Mugello special £75. After some investigation I thought these were ok prices championship winning. Also got a reynolds 2004 gixxer on pre-order.

Also I just got a Swap Meet email (below) that might be of interest to fellow enthusiasts. I've also been wondering what might be very collectable in years to come. I see minichamps are going to do a fast freddie & wayne gardiner rep with limited numbers. Also the Rocket III, which is not my cup of tea, I was wondering if that might be sought after in the future.

I wondering if I should try and find a sado forum for minichamp bike collectors (or start one)
